  • Maefleur on December 03, 2018

    I didn't have any rosemary as the recipe suggests, so used a combination of fresh thyme, oregano and sage, along with the flakey sea salt and the garlic in their papery shells. The garlic cooked up perfectly tender and the honey added just a touch of sweetness.
